It appears you have a set of four Presidential Dollar coins featuring Chester A. Arthur, Grover Cleveland (both of his non-consecutive terms), and Benjamin Harrison, presented in a case. Here's some information about each coin and the series in general:
1. **Chester A. Arthur**:
- Chester A. Arthur served as the 21st President of the United States from 1881 to 1885.
- He succeeded James Garfield after his assassination.
- His Presidential Dollar coin typically features his portrait on the obverse and the Statue of Liberty on the reverse.
2. **Grover Cleveland (First Term)**:
- Grover Cleveland served as the 22nd President of the United States from 1885 to 1889.
- He was the first Democratic president since the Civil War.
- His Presidential Dollar coin features his portrait on the obverse and the Statue of Liberty on the reverse.
3. **Grover Cleveland (Second Term)**:
- Grover Cleveland served as the 24th President of the United States from 1893 to 1897, making him the only U.S. president to serve two non-consecutive terms.
- His Presidential Dollar coin also features his portrait on the obverse and the Statue of Liberty on the reverse.
4. **Benjamin Harrison**:
- Benjamin Harrison served as the 23rd President of the United States from 1889 to 1893.
- He was the grandson of William Henry Harrison, the 9th President of the United States.
- His Presidential Dollar coin features his portrait on the obverse and the Statue of Liberty on the reverse.
The Presidential Dollar Series, launched in 2007, honored each U.S. president with a unique coin design. The series continued until 2016, with each president being featured on a separate coin issued in chronological order of their presidency. These coins are often collected by numismatists and history enthusiasts.
